January 17, 2020 (PROVIDENCE, RI) – Conservation Law Foundation (CLF) released the following statement today after Governor Raimondo signed an executive order requiring all of Rhode Island’s electricity come from renewable sources by 2030.

“The reality of the climate crisis demands that we end our reliance on dirty fossil fuels,” said CLF Senior Attorney Jerry Elmer. “This commitment to 100% renewable electricity is a major step towards reaching that goal. The Governor must now make good on her promise to support a law that goes beyond mere talk and makes Rhode Island’s climate goals mandatory, including slashing emissions beyond the electric sector.”
